Recommended! Because of its public domain status in its most well-known (and
inferior) version and worn-looking prints, Orson Welles' Mr. Arkadin has long
been regarded as a sour note in the director's career. While it doesn't reach
the heights of Citizen Kane or Chimes at Midnight, it is nevertheless a
fascinating part of the director's cinematic work. A more troubled film than
most in Welles' parade of troubled projects, Arkadin will hopefully see a
renaissance of sorts with this sterling effort from Criterion, who presents
viewers with three different versions of the film with supportive arguments for
each. Not only that, but an array of extras are on hand to flesh out the story
of bedeviled production issues and a confusing history. For fans, it is a
treasure trove of material not to be missed.
